Jaxon Smith-Njigba, a wide receiver for the Seattle Seahawks, highlighted a mistake on his Offensive Player of the Year trophy, which incorrectly labeled him as the Defensive Player of the Year. He expressed his frustration on social media, calling the error disrespectful. The NFL will need to rectify the situation by issuing a corrected trophy.
